Understanding details related to the Amazon rainforest is of significant importance due to the ecosystem’s pivotal role in global climate regulation and biodiversity conservation. Its extensive forests absorb substantial amounts of carbon dioxide, acting as a crucial carbon sink. Furthermore, the rainforest harbors an unparalleled diversity of plant and animal species, many of which are still undiscovered. Historically, it has provided indigenous communities with sustenance, medicine, and cultural identity, highlighting its intricate relationship with human societies.
